The Grants Specialist & Donor Relations Manager plays a vital role in the success of Lutheran Family Services Rocky Mountains fund development efforts. This position supports grant prospecting writing and reporting while also managing relationships with donors and major gift prospects. The Specialist will identify cultivate solicit and steward donors assist in planning fundraising events and act as a primary contact for assigned donors and grantors. The role emphasizes securing gifts retaining and strengthening existing giving and ensuring timely and accurate completion of grant-related tasks.

EXAMPLE ACTIVITIES

  • Identify and build relationships with potential donors and funders.
  • Secure commitments of participation or donations from individuals foundations or corporate donors.
  • Write and send letters of thanks to donors.
  • Solicit cash in-kind donations or sponsorships from individuals business or government donors.
  • Update donor and grant databases.
  • Assist with developing strategies to encourage new or increased contributions.
  • Assist with developing new grant proposals that meet the agencys current needs.
  • Develop and implement fundraising activities such as annual giving campaigns giving society events and donor events.
  • Compile or develop materials to submit to granting or other funding organizations.

Lutheran Family Services Rocky Mountains is a faith based, non-profit human services agency providing adoption, disaster response, foster care, older adult, family support & education, and refugee & immigration services since 1948.
